Power Plant
Scholven power station
57th-largest power plant in Germany of 335 · top 18% worldwide (#5,110 of 29,849)
- Owner
- Uniper Kraftwerke GmbH
- Status
- operating
- Capacity
- 878 MW
- Fuel
- coal
- Commissioned
- 1968
